数码帮手
白蓝主题五 · 清爽阅读
首页  > 上网防护

协议栈优化影响网络吗?真相和你想象的不一样

家里Wi-Fi信号满格,但刷视频还是卡顿,打游戏延迟高得离谱。很多人第一反应是路由器不行、宽带不够,其实问题可能出在你设备的“协议”上。

什么是协议栈

简单说,协议栈就是操作系统里负责处理网络通信的一套底层机制。从你点开网页到加载内容,每一步都靠它协调。常见的TCP/IP协议栈就属于这一类。它决定了数据怎么拆包、传输、重传、确认,直接影响上网体验。

协议栈,真的能提速?

有人觉得“优化”就是提速,其实不一定。比如把TCP窗口调大,理论上能一次传更多数据,适合高速宽带。但在信号差的环境下,反而会因为频繁丢包导致重传加剧,网速更慢。

再比如关闭Nagle算法,能减少小数据包的等待时间,对打游戏、语音通话有帮助。但如果你只是看视频、刷微博,几乎感觉不到差别,还可能增加网络负担。

改注册表就能“飞”?小心适得其反

网上流传各种“一键优化脚本”或修改Windows注册表参数的教程,比如调整TcpWindowSize、EnablePMTUDiscovery等。这些操作看似专业,实则风险不小。

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Tcpip\Parameters]
"TcpWindowSize"=dword:00040000
"EnablePMTUDiscovery"=dword:00000001

这类修改一旦出错,可能导致连接不稳定、某些网站打不开,甚至系统更新失败。而且现代操作系统本身就有智能调节机制,手动干预往往画蛇添足。

什么时候需要关注协议栈?

如果你经常远程办公、跑虚拟机、用NAS传大文件,或者玩低延迟要求高的竞技游戏,适当了解协议栈设置是有意义的。但普通用户完全没必要折腾。大多数情况下,系统默认配置已经针对多数场景做过平衡。

反倒是路由器固件更新、网卡驱动升级、关闭后台偷跑的应用,这些更实际的做法,比动协议栈见效更快。

别被“加速”噱头忽悠了

市面上一些所谓的“网络加速器”,其实就是偷偷改了几项协议栈参数,然后告诉你“已优化”。实际效果因人而异,有的人变快了,是因为关掉了某些限制;有的人反而更卡,是因为环境不匹配。

网络体验是综合结果,不是单靠改几个参数就能翻天覆地。与其盲目优化协议栈,不如先检查是不是手机连了太多设备,或者路由器放在角落被冰箱挡着。